How are the animation companies Toei and Akom similiar, are they related or not?

Postby giantrobotlover8806 » Sun Sep 26, 2010 5:19 am

Because Toei and Akom did the animation for the original 1980's G1 cartoon, and many other 80's cartoon and well into the 90's. I know that Toei is from Japan, and Akom is from South Korea, but yet their animation looks identical. I know that the vast majority of the episodes of the Transformers G1 cartoon was done by Toei, but most of season 2 and early season 3, and season 4 rebirth episodes were done by Akom. Anyway, do the companies Toei and Akom work together?

There's no relation that I've been able to find. I think whatever consistency there is in G1 is more due to Sunbow's and Marvel's requirements than any cooperation between Toei, AKOM and the unnamed Filipino studio. Toei is notorious for being touchy to work with, and AKOM is infamous for sloppy work (Bruce Timm did fire them from working on Batman TAS, after all).

Transformers always had animation errors but it seems like of all the studios Akom was the biggest offender. their episodes had more errors than Toeis.

Toei's artwork and character models seemed more detailed with more shadows and shading. Akom's looked more flat. The actual animation even seemed smoother in the Toei episodes.

Its funny cause I LIKE some of the Akom animated episodes like Dark Awakening and City of Steel a lot and only imagine how much better they would be if Toei had worked on them.
